IAudioSessionControl::GetDisplayName-Methode (audiopolicy.h)
Die GetDisplayName-Methode ruft den Anzeigenamen für die Audiositzung ab.
Syntax
HRESULT GetDisplayName(
[out] LPWSTR *pRetVal
);
Parameter
[out] pRetVal
Zeiger auf eine Zeigervariable, in die die -Methode die Adresse einer mit NULL beendeten breitzeichenigen Zeichenfolge schreibt, die den Anzeigenamen enthält. Die -Methode weist den Speicher für die Zeichenfolge zu. Der Aufrufer ist für das Freigeben des Speichers verantwortlich, wenn er nicht mehr benötigt wird, indem er die CoTaskMemFree-Funktion aufruft . Informationen zu CoTaskMemFree finden Sie in der Dokumentation zum Windows SDK.
Rückgabewert
Wenn die Methode erfolgreich ist, wird S_OK zurückgegeben. Wenn ein Fehler auftritt, können mögliche Rückgabecodes die in der folgenden Tabelle gezeigten Werte umfassen, sind jedoch nicht darauf beschränkt.
Rückgabecode | Beschreibung |
---|---|
|
Der Parameter pRetVal ist NULL. |
|
Nicht genügend Arbeitsspeicher. |
|
Das Audioendpunktgerät wurde getrennt, oder die Audiohardware oder die zugehörigen Hardwareressourcen wurden neu konfiguriert, deaktiviert, entfernt oder anderweitig für die Verwendung nicht verfügbar gemacht. |
|
Der Windows-Audiodienst wird nicht ausgeführt. |
Hinweise
Wenn der Client nicht IAudioSessionControl::SetDisplayName aufgerufen hat, um den Anzeigenamen festzulegen, ist die Zeichenfolge leer. Anstatt eine leere Namenszeichenfolge anzuzeigen, verwendet das Sndvol-Programm einen automatisch generierten Standardnamen, um die Lautstärkesteuerung für die Audiositzung zu bezeichnen.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ows Vista [Desktop-Apps | UWP-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2008 [Desktop-Apps | UWP-Apps] |
Zielplattform | Windows |
Kopfzeile | audiopolicy.h |